Hollister Tremors U13 Boys Competitive Team Dominates CCSL

The Tremors U13 team will go on to compete in the 2018 Watsonville Indoor Soccer League.

The Hollister Tremors Competitive U13 boys took first place in the CCSL (Cal North Competitive Soccer League) Gold Bay Region, this 2017 Fall Season.

With 10 games played and only one loss the team had the best overall goal-differential, securing them the first place win.

The boys, who range from ages eleven to twelve years, defeated teams from San Jose-Alum Rock, Half Moon Bay, Sunnyvale, Santa Cruz and Palo Alto. 

Coach Refugio "Cuco" Sanchez and Assistant Coaches Sergio Ramirez Sr., Hernan Alvarez Sr, and Ignacio Moran train players year-round for their ongoing success.

They will be continuing their journey to compete in the 2018 Watsonville Indoor Soccer League over the Winter.

The season runs from January 2018 to March 2018. Last season the team went undefeated in the 2017 Winter indoor season, taking 1st place in the league.
